Hi, I am trying to use SRFI-48 under Guile and Gauche for formatting fixed point output. Thanks for creating the SRFI - here is some feedback, I have tested SRFI-48 using the code posted here on Jun 5th (there is no version in source code) using both Guile and Gauche Scheme interpreters and I find the following apparent formatting errors: ======================================================================= **FAIL: expected: " 1.026" got: " 1.260" from: (format "~10,3F" 1.0256) **FAIL: expected: " 1.002" got: " 1.200" from: (format "~10,3F" 1.0025) **FAIL: expected: " 1.003" got: " 1.300" from: (format "~10,3F" 1.00256) **FAIL: expected: "1.000012" got: "1.120000" from: (format "~8,6F" 1.00001234) ======================================================================= Here are the tests that were run: ======================================================================= ;;; ;;; test cases for srfi-48a.scm ;;; 22-Jun-2005 Stephen Lewis <[email protected]> ;;; ;;; run under Guile version 1.6.4 'guile -s test2-48.scm' ;;; and under Gauche version 0.8.4 'gosh test2-48.scm' ;;; (load "./srfi-48a.scm") ;;; ;;; Guile and Gauche 'eval' takes 2 args ;;; (define-macro (expect expected form . compare) (let* ( (same? (if (null? compare) equal? (eval (car `,compare) (current-module) ))) (wanted (eval `,expected (current-module) )) (actual (eval `,form (current-module) )) ) (if (same? wanted actual) (format #t "PASSED: ~s~%" form) (format #t "~%**FAIL: expected: ~s~% got: ~s~% from: ~s~%" wanted actual form)) ) ) ;;;=================================================== (expect " 1.026" (format "~10,3F" 1.0256)) (expect " 1.002" (format "~10,3F" 1.0025)) (expect " 1.003" (format "~10,3F" 1.00256)) (expect "1.000012" (format "~8,6F" 1.00001234)) ======================================================================= Stephen Lewis
